Grandera outpaces favourite Hawk Wing

Published September 8, 2002

DUBLIN, Sept 7: The Dubai-based Godolphin Operation’s Grandera won a thrilling Irish Champion Stakes here at Leopardstown Saturday to push champion Irish trainer Aidan O’Brien into second for the second successive year.

Star Italian rider Frankie Dettori got Grandera up literally on the line to edge Irish favourite Hawk Wing by a short head with another Godolphin entry Best of the Bests third.

While Grandera’s win pushed him further ahead in the World Series standings Hawk Wing was left filling the bridesmaid’s role in a Group One race for the third time this season having finished second in the English 2000 Guineas and English Derby behind his stablemates Rock of Gibraltar and High Chapparal respectively.—AFP
